/* $Id: atomic.h,v 1.3 2001/07/25 16:15:19 bjornw Exp $ */#ifndef __ASM_CRIS_ATOMIC__#define __ASM_CRIS_ATOMIC__#include <asm/system.h>/* * Atomic operations that C can't guarantee us.  Useful for * resource counting etc.. *//* * Make sure gcc doesn't try to be clever and move things around * on us. We need to use _exactly_ the address the user gave us, * not some alias that contains the same information. */#define __atomic_fool_gcc(x) (*(struct { int a[100]; } *)x)typedef struct { int counter; } atomic_t;#define ATOMIC_INIT(i)  { (i) }#define atomic_read(v) ((v)->counter)#define atomic_set(v,i) (((v)->counter) = (i))/* These should be written in asm but we do it in C for now. */extern __inline__ void atomic_add(int i, volatile atomic_t *v){	unsigned long flags;	local_save_flags(flags);	local_irq_disable();	v->counter += i;	local_irq_restore(flags);}extern __inline__ void atomic_sub(int i, volatile atomic_t *v){	unsigned long flags;	local_save_flags(flags);	local_irq_disable();	v->counter -= i;	local_irq_restore(flags);}extern __inline__ int atomic_add_return(int i, volatile atomic_t *v){	unsigned long flags;	int retval;	local_save_flags(flags);	local_irq_disable();	retval = (v->counter += i);	local_irq_restore(flags);	return retval;}#define atomic_add_negative(a, v)	(atomic_add_return((a), (v)) < 0)extern __inline__ int atomic_sub_return(int i, volatile atomic_t *v){	unsigned long flags;	int retval;	local_save_flags(flags);	local_irq_disable();	retval = (v->counter -= i);	local_irq_restore(flags);	return retval;}extern __inline__ int atomic_sub_and_test(int i, volatile atomic_t *v){	int retval;	unsigned long flags;	local_save_flags(flags);	local_irq_disable();	retval = (v->counter -= i) == 0;	local_irq_restore(flags);	return retval;}extern __inline__ void atomic_inc(volatile atomic_t *v){	unsigned long flags;	local_save_flags(flags);	local_irq_disable();	(v->counter)++;	local_irq_restore(flags);}extern __inline__ void atomic_dec(volatile atomic_t *v){	unsigned long flags;	local_save_flags(flags);	local_irq_disable();	(v->counter)--;	local_irq_restore(flags);}extern __inline__ int atomic_inc_return(volatile atomic_t *v){	unsigned long flags;	int retval;	local_save_flags(flags);	local_irq_disable();	retval = (v->counter)++;	local_irq_restore(flags);	return retval;}extern __inline__ int atomic_dec_return(volatile atomic_t *v){	unsigned long flags;	int retval;	local_save_flags(flags);	local_irq_disable();	retval = (v->counter)--;	local_irq_restore(flags);	return retval;}extern __inline__ int atomic_dec_and_test(volatile atomic_t *v){	int retval;	unsigned long flags;	local_save_flags(flags);	local_irq_disable();	retval = --(v->counter) == 0;	local_irq_restore(flags);	return retval;}extern __inline__ int atomic_inc_and_test(volatile atomic_t *v){	int retval;	unsigned long flags;	local_save_flags(flags);	local_irq_disable();	retval = ++(v->counter) == 0;	local_irq_restore(flags);	return retval;}/* Atomic operations are already serializing */#define smp_mb__before_atomic_dec()    barrier()#define smp_mb__after_atomic_dec()     barrier()#define smp_mb__before_atomic_inc()    barrier()#define smp_mb__after_atomic_inc()     barrier()#endif
